    Sound disabled after downloading Windows 7 SP1


    Hi, downloaded Windows7 SP1 on an HP Pavilion laptop and since then get a message that my speakers are disabled (as are headphones). The drivers claim to be up to date, I've tried disinstalling them, updating nothing seems to work....worse still when I tried to run system restore I discovered that I hadn't set a restore point ( I'm sure it told me it was doing this during SP1 download) any ideas?
